Dad's Strawberry Cream Puffs

Serves 12 | Prep Time 15 minutes | Cook Time 30-35 minutes

Why I Love This Recipe

My dad makes these every summer. They are simply wonderful, with strawberries fresh from his garden.


Ingredients You'll Need

1 cup water

1/2 cup butter

1 teaspoon sugar

1/4 teaspoon salt

1 cup all-purpose flour

4 eggs

Filling:

2 pints fresh strawberries, sliced

1/2 cup sugar, divided

2 cups whipping cream

Confectioners’ sugar

Additional sliced strawberries for garnish


Directions

In a large saucepan, bring water, butter, sugar and salt to a boil. Add flour all at once and stir until smooth ball forms. Remove from the heat; let stand for 5 minutes. Add eggs one at a time, beating well after each addition. Continue beating until mixture is smooth and shiny.


Drop by 12 rounded tablespoonfuls 3 inches apart onto a greased baking sheet.


Bake at 375 degrees for 30 to 35 minutes or until golden brown. Transfer to a wire rack. Immediately cut a slit in each puff to allow steam to escape; cool.


Split puffs and set tops aside; remove soft dough from inside with a fork. Cool puffs.


For filling, combine berries and 1/4 cup sugar, chill for 30 minutes.


Beat cream and remaining sugar until stiff. Fold in berries.


Fill cream puffs and replace tops.
